Overview

Wular Lake, located in the Bandipora district of Jammu and Kashmir, is one of the largest freshwater lakes in Asia. This expansive and serene lake is renowned for its stunning natural beauty, diverse ecosystem, and rich cultural significance. Surrounded by majestic mountains and lush green landscapes, Wular Lake offers a tranquil escape for nature lovers and birdwatchers. The lake's calm waters reflect the sky and surrounding hills, creating a picturesque setting that captivates visitors.

Wular Lake plays a crucial role in supporting the region's biodiversity. It is a vital habitat for various species of fish, birds, and aquatic plants. Birdwatchers can spot a wide range of migratory and resident birds, making it a paradise for ornithologists. The lake's ecosystem also supports local fishing communities, who depend on its abundant fish resources for their livelihoods. Boating and fishing are popular activities, allowing visitors to explore the lake's vast expanse and appreciate its natural splendor.

In addition to its ecological importance, Wular Lake has historical and cultural significance. The ancient town of Sopore, located near the lake, has been a prominent trading hub for centuries. The lake itself has been mentioned in historical texts and has been a source of inspiration for poets and artists. Efforts are being made to conserve and restore Wular Lake, addressing environmental challenges such as siltation and pollution.
